From Zero to Hero: Panduan Pemula untuk Pengembangan Android
Halo, Sobat Akhyar Media Kreatif! Anda mungkin memiliki impian untuk menjadi seorang developer Android yang handal, namun terkadang merasa kebingungan harus mulai dari mana. Jangan khawatir, karena dalam artikel ini kita akan membahas langkah-langkah dasar untuk memulai perjalananmu dalam pengembangan aplikasi Android.
Memahami Dasar-dasar Pengembangan Android
Pertama-tama, jangan terburu-buru untuk mulai coding tanpa memahami dasar-dasar Android Development. Anda perlu memahami bahasa pemrograman Java, XML, dan pengetahuan umum tentang Android Studio. Pastikan untuk memahami konsep dasar seperti Activity, Intent, dan Layout.
menginstal Android Studio
Langkah selanjutnya adalah menginstal Android Studio, IDE resmi yang digunakan untuk mengembangkan aplikasi Android. Android Studio dilengkapi dengan berbagai fitur yang memudahkan pengembangan aplikasi, seperti emulator untuk menguji aplikasi tanpa perlu perangkat fisik.
Membuat Proyek Pertamamu
Setelah menginstal Android Studio, saatnya untuk membuat proyek pertamamu. Mulailah dengan membuat project baru, pilihlah template yang sesuai dengan jenis aplikasi yang ingin kamu buat, dan atur konfigurasi project sesuai kebutuhanmu.
Belajar Layout XML
Layout XML digunakan untuk merancang tata letak antarmuka pengguna aplikasi Android. Pelajari tentang berbagai jenis tata letak seperti RelativeLayout, LinearLayout, dan ConstraintLayout, serta cara menggabungkan widget-widget seperti Button, TextView, dan ImageView.
Aktivitas Pengenal
Aktivitas merupakan komponen utama dalam pengembangan aplikasi Android. Pelajari cara membuat dan mengelola Aktivitas, serta bagaimana Aktivitas berinteraksi satu sama lain melalui Intent.
Pahami Maksudnya
Intent digunakan untuk berkomunikasi antara komponen-komponen dalam aplikasi Android, seperti Activity dan Service. Pelajari jenis tentang-jenis Intent seperti Implisit dan Eksplisit, serta cara mengirim data antar Aktivitas.
Menulis Kode Java
Selanjutnya, pelajari bahasa pemrograman Java yang digunakan dalam pengembangan aplikasi Android. Mulailah dengan memahami konsep dasar seperti variabel, kontrol alur, dan penggunaan perpustakaan.
Fungsionalitas Implementasi
Selanjutnya, mengimplementasikan fungsionalitas dalam aplikasimu. Mulailah dengan fitur-fitur sederhana seperti menampilkan teks atau gambar, kemudian lanjutkan dengan fitur-fitur yang lebih kompleks seperti penyimpanan data lokal atau penggunaan API.
Pengujian dan Debugging
Sebuah aplikasi tidak lengkap tanpa proses pengujian dan debugging yang baik. Gunakan emulator untuk menguji aplikasimu dalam berbagai kondisi, dan gunakan fitur debugging untuk menemukan dan memperbaiki bug-bug yang muncul.
Optimasi Performa
Terakhir, pastikan untuk mengoptimalkan kinerja aplikasimu. penggunaan resource yang berlebihan, mengoptimalkan penggunaan memori dan CPU, serta memastikan aplikasimu responsif dan lancar dalam berbagai kondisi.
Menjadi Pengembang Android yang Handal
Dengan mengikuti langkah-langkah di atas, kamu akan memiliki dasar yang kuat untuk menjadi seorang pengembang Android yang handal. Ingatlah bahwa pengembangan aplikasi Android membutuhkan kesabaran, ketekunan, dan dedikasi untuk terus belajar dan mengembangkan kemampuanmu. Selamat belajar dan semoga sukses dalam perjalananmu!
Jumpa lagi di artikel menarik lainnya, Sobat Akhyar Media Kreatif!